Community Foundation cancels Nourish the North fundraiser

Aug 23, 2018 | 5:40 AM

The Community Foundation of Northwestern Alberta will have one less tool to help reach their goal of raising $10-million by 2020. 

Nourish the North, an annual wine and auction fundraiser for the organization has been cancelled. CEO Tracey Vavrek says the board of directors are focused on building a strong sustainability plan which includes growing endowment funds. 

“It was truly about what was right for the community. We care about this community and we are here to make sure the community is strong. We know we have immense support at the Community Foundation and we are seeing the support in our endowment building. That is really important and that is critical.”

She says when the economy grows so do the needs of the community.

“We, as the Community Foundation, are there to support the other charities and that is our purpose. When we started to evaluate the support that we have received in our sponsorship and ticket sales, we recognized that if we cancelled the event and put our energy into helping other organizations, that is better for our community.” 

Vavrek also points to leaving room for other events to be successful which is in line with their mission.

The CFNW’s next event is Invest Northwest on December 5.
